Arsene Wenger has suggested that Arsenal would be unable to afford Monaco forward Kylian Mbappe. Mbappe, 18, is enjoying an impressive breakthrough season, with his 21 goals helping Monaco to the top of Ligue 1 and into the Champions League semifinals, as well as the last four of the Coupe de France and Coupe de la Ligue final.
